美文网首页
Shell 数组使用及遍历

Shell 数组使用及遍历

作者: 数据小白鼠 | 来源:发表于2018-06-25 14:37 被阅读0次

    Shell 中数组的定义及遍历,示例:

     #!/bin/bash
    
    #定义方法一  数组定义为空格分割
    array=('a' 'b' 'c' 'd' 'e')
    
    #定义方法二  
    arrayIndex[0]=1
    arrayIndex[1]=2
    arrayIndex[2]=3
    arrayIndex[3]=4
    arrayIndex[4]=5
    
    #修改数组值
    array[0]='f'
    arrayIndex[1]=6
    
    #打印数组长度
    echo ${#arrayIndex[@]}
    
    #for 遍历数组
    for var in ${arrayIndex[@]}
    do
      echo $var
    done
    
    #while 遍历数组
    i=0
    while  [[ i -lt ${#arrayIndex[@]} ]];do
      echo ${arrayIndex[i]}
      let i++
    done
    

    相关文章

      网友评论

          本文标题:Shell 数组使用及遍历

          本文链接:https://www.haomeiwen.com/subject/kdryyftx.html